Carrot Mezhukkupuratti Recipe (Kerala Carrot Stir Fry)

Aarthi
Carrot Mezhukkupurati is a simple and healthy Kerala style stir fry which is made with fresh carrots, beans and a flavourful coconut oil based seasoning. This classic dish is mildly spiced and loaded with natural sweetness of carrots.

Ingredients
  

  • 2 tablespoon Coconut Oil
  • 1 teaspoon Mustard Seeds
  • 1 teaspoon Split Urad Dal
  • 1 sprig Curry leaves

For Vegetables

  • 2 large Carrots chopped
  • 10 no Green Beans chopped
  • Salt to taste

To Grind

  • 5 no Shallots (Sambar Onion) Peeled
  • 4 cloves Garlic peeled
  • 1 teaspoon Red Chilli Powder
  • 1 teaspoon Turmeric Powder

Instructions
 

  • Pre-prep - Wash, peel and chop carrots and beans into small pieces. Peel shallots and garlic.
  • Grinding - Grind shallots, garlic, chilli powder and turmeric powder into coarse paste.Don’t need to add water. Keep the tempering ingredients ready.
  • Steaming vegetable - Add chopped carrots and beans to a pan with a little water and salt. Cover and cook for 10 mins until veggies are tender. Keep this aside.
  • Cooking - Heat coconut oil in a separate pan. Add mustard seeds, let them splutter. Add urad dal and curry leaves. Saute till dal turns golden. Add the ground masala paste and saute for 2-4 mins on medium flame. Add the cooked vegetables, mix well and adjust salt if needed. Cook everything together for another 5 mins u til dry and well combined. Serve hot with rice.
